1. Flower Colors – Although many people associate wedding bouquets with spring, the most romantic colour is red. This is a warm color which is a great base for your fall wedding bouquet. Instead of mixing your red with a pink of spring, consider a deep saffron color. These mixed with rich green leaves will form a spectacular fall wedding bouquet.
2. Colors For Your Ribbons – Hand tied wedding bouquets are very popular, these offer a great opportunity to add an extra color to your wedding color theme. If your bouquet is going to be deep rich colors, you may want to choose a color which will sparkle or lighten the look. This can be achieved with the metallic looking color range, especially a gold color.
3. Continuing Your Color Theme – The colors you use on your wedding day will be crucial to the atmosphere you want to create. It is always a good idea to continue the color theme of your bouquet throughout the wedding. For example, if you have decided to choose a gold ribbon for your bouquet you can have the same color in the brides maids hair, or edging the ring cushion held by the page boy.
To continue the theme across the reception you could match the color of your napkins to the ribbon of your bouquet, or base your floral table center pieces around your wedding bouquet.
